    summer travel

    I just finished my summer jaunt. I have a 1964 41dcmy, 6v51 diesel engines. We took the boat out for the entire summer. Went from Toronto Ontario, to Montreal Quebec via St. Lawrence River. Stayed in the old port of Montreal for 5 days. Then on to Ottawa via Ottawa River. Stayed for 8 days,tied up by the National Arts Center. From there, Down the Rideau Canal to Kingston Ont, and back to Toronto. Other than hitting a submerged log ( $800.00 prop repair and 5 days waiting in Merrickville Ont.---the wilderness) everything ran perfectly. The stbd. engine smoked a little at 2300 rpm (light grey in color) but the oil consumption did not vary from past trips.
